Return-Path: Received: (majordomo@vger.kernel.org) by vger.kernel.org via listexpand id S1755629AbbLANcv (ORCPT ); Tue, 1 Dec 2015 08:32:51 -0500 Received: from mga14.intel.com ([192.55.52.115]:50284 "EHLO mga14.intel.com" rhost-flags-OK-OK-OK-OK) by vger.kernel.org with ESMTP id S1755109AbbLANct (ORCPT ); Tue, 1 Dec 2015 08:32:49 -0500 X-ExtLoop1: 1 X-IronPort-AV: E=Sophos;i="5.20,369,1444719600"; d="scan'208";a="851409473" From: Heikki Krogerus To: Chanwoo Choi , Greg Kroah-Hartman Cc: MyungJoo Ham , David Cohen , Lu Baolu , Mathias Nyman , linux-usb@vger.kernel.org, lin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org Subject: [PATCH 1/2] extcon: add driver for Intel USB mux Date: Tue, 1 Dec 2015 15:32:37 +0200 Message-Id: <1448976758-35807-2-git-send-email-heikki.krogerus@linux.intel.com> X-Mailer: git-send-email 2.6.2 In-Reply-To: <1448976758-35807-1-git-send-email-heikki.krogerus@linux.intel.com> References: <1448976758-35807-1-git-send-email-heikki.krogerus@linux.intel.com> Sender: linux-kernel-owner@vger.kernel.org List-ID: X-Mailing-List: lin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org Content-Length: 5907 Lines: 201 Several Intel PCHs and SOCs have an internal mux that is used to share one USB port between USB Device Controller and xHCI. The mux is normally handled by System FW/BIOS, but not always. For those platforms where the FW does not take care of the mux, this driver is needed.
